Rolling coverage of the latest economic and financial news, including the latest UK GDP report which is released at 7am GMT

Any relief if the UK has avoided recession at the end of last year will be short-lived, fears Adam Cole, chief currency strategist at RBC Europe.

Cole predicts the economy will shrink in the current quarter:

The monthly GDP outturns for October and November and December mean that the UK economy likely avoided a recession in calendar year 2022, if only just.

Relief is likely to be short lived, however. The January PMI surveys suggested that activity weakened at the beginning of Q1 2023 and we currently see GDP contracting by 0.3% q/q.
